Key Projects Across Kansas and Missouri Our Kansas Division leads the management of complex roadway projects, ensuring effective execution, compliance, and quality outcomes. K-27 Corridor Improvements - A major corridor modernization project to reconstruct approximately nine miles of K-27 on a new westward alignment, enhancing safety with a flatter profile, improved intersection sight distances, and paved shoulders between the Smoky Hill River and Zig-Zag Road. This work supports improved roadway performance, increased reliability, and long-term operational efficiency on a key rural arterial route. US-24 Corridor Management Plan - A comprehensive update to the US-24 Corridor Management Plan that reassesses land use, access management, and transportation needs across an expanded corridor segment to guide investment and safety improvements over the next 20 years. The study will evaluate existing planning documents, forecast growth trends, and recommend multimodal mobility and safety strategies to support future development and traffic operations. MoDOT Southwest District STIP Planning - Support planning and coordination of the Missouri Department of Transportation's Southwest District elements of the 2025-2029 Statewide Transportation Improvement Program (STIP), including scoping, design prioritization, and advancement of highway and bridge projects that align funding, program goals, and regional needs ahead of the FY 2026-2030 cycle. The work contributes to defining project schedules, budgets, and technical scopes for delivery across the district's multimodal network. Marlatt Avenue Improvements - A collaborative roadway enhancement project to widen and reconstruct Marlatt Avenue on the north side of Manhattan, KS, improving traffic flow, safety, and multimodal connectivity while supporting access to local destinations and planned community growth. The improvements include updated pavement sections, upgraded intersections, and enhancements for pedestrians and cyclists along this key corridor. KDOT K-32 & 4th Street Improvements - A corridor enhancement effort focused on modernizing the K-32 and 4th Street intersection and adjoining segments to improve traffic operations, multimodal connectivity, and safety along this key regional thoroughfare connecting Bonner Springs and Edwardsville. The work supports operational reliability and better integration with local street networks in this growing area. How much does an associate project manager earn in Overland Park, KS?

The average associate project manager in Overland Park, KS earns between $49,000 and $174,000 annually. This compares to the national average associate project manager range of $52,000 to $153,000.
